JBL Flip 5 vs Marshall Stockwell II
The JBL Flip 5 is a great Portable Bluetooth Speaker for its $119 asking price.
The Marshall Stockwell II, however, is merely passable at its $199 price point. If you're considering buying a Portable Bluetooth Speaker in the $160 range, you might want to check out some of its competitors.
The JBL Flip 5 has done great in quite a few roundups from some of the most highly trusted sources available, such as CNET, Rtings, and TechGearLab, which perform high-quality in-depth testing. It got awarded the "Best design" title by CNET, "Best Budget JBL Speaker" by Rtings, and "A Worthy, Waterproof, Bose Alternative" by TechGearLab in their respective roundups. Earning that much praise from such respected sources is undoubtedly an impressive accomplishment.
As for the Marshall Stockwell II, it wasn't able to earn a top spot in any roundups from trusted sources that conduct their own hands-on testing. Nevertheless, it managed to impress reviewers at PCmag, Reviewed, and Wirecutter (NYTimes) enough to make it onto their respective shortlists.
We examined all of the review data that we could find and first took a look at sources that reviewed both of them, like Pocket-lint and PCmag, and found that they haven't shown a preference for either product.
Then we checked which sources liked these two Portable Bluetooth Speakers best and found that the JBL Flip 5 got its highest, 10, review score from reviewers at TechGearLab, whereas the Marshall Stockwell II earned its best score of 9.2 from Gadget Review.
Lastly, we averaged out all of the reviews scores that we could find on these two products and compared them to other Portable Bluetooth Speakers on the market. We learned that both of them performed far better than most of their competitors - the overall review average earned by Portable Bluetooth Speakers being 7.6 out of 10, whereas the JBL Flip 5 and Marshall Stockwell II managed averages of 8.4 and 8.4 points, respectively.
Due to the difference in their prices, however, it's important to keep in mind that a direct JBL Flip 5 vs. Marshall Stockwell II comparison might not be entirely fair - some sources don't take value for money into account when assigning their scores and therefore have a tendency to rate more premium products better.
